The Charles City Community School District, or Charles City Schools is a public school district headquartered in Charles City, Iowa. [1]Occupying sections of Floyd and Chickasaw counties, it serves Charles City, Colwell, Floyd, and the surrounding rural areas.

Charles City Junior-Senior High School, also known as the North Grand Building, is a historic building located in Charles City, Iowa, United States. It replaced a high school building completed in 1899 that was destroyed in a fire.

There were two former institutions called Charles City College, the first a Methodist college that was absorbed into Morningside College in the 1910s, and the second a short lived branch of Parsons College in the late 1960s.
